The Director Controller role is responsible for overseeing the banks accounting and financial reporting functions ensuring accuracy integrity and compliance with GAAP regulatory requirements and internal controls. This role leads the financial close process manages accounting operations supports audits and regulatory examinations and partners with Finance and business leaders to support sound financial management.
- Oversees the banks accounting operations and financial close process ensuring timely accurate monthly quarterly and annual financial statements in accordance with GAAP and regulatory requirements.
- Ensures compliance with banking regulations and reporting requirements including Call Reports and other regulatory filings and serve as a key point of contact for regulatory examinations.
- Maintains and strengthens internal controls over financial reporting including oversight of SOX policies and procedures.
- Supports external and internal audits including coordination with auditors preparation of audit schedules and resolution of audit findings.
- Develops maintains and governs accounting policies position papers technical accounting memos and accounting procedures.
- Establishes governance over accounting data reports system interfaces reconciliations and key financial reporting dependencies.
- Oversees general ledger and key accounting estimates including allowances accruals and valuation reserves.
- Partners with Treasury Risk and FP&A to ensure alignment between financial reporting liquidity capital and balance sheet activities.
- Leads and develops the accounting team providing guidance performance management and support for professional development.
- Supports financial reporting enhancements and system initiatives including accounting system upgrades process improvements and automation efforts.
